Mugwort vs Wormwood: Know the Difference, Use with Confidence
When the terms "mugwort" and "wormwood" come up, it is easy to get tangled in myths rooted in absinthe lore, medieval medicine, or just plain grocery store mix-ups. Both belong to the Artemisia family—but that shared heritage does not make them interchangeable. Knowing which herb fits which kitchen task or wellness approach can transform not just recipes, but well‑being routines too. This guide dives into the botanical truths, historical uses, and smart safety tips.


USDA Organic Certification in Supplements: What It Guarantees
“Organic” is more than a trend — it’s a priority for millions of Americans who want clean, naturally sourced products. While organic labels are familiar on produce and packaged foods, they are also important in the supplement industry.The USDA Organic seal is one of the most trusted certifications in the U.S. It assures consumers that supplements are made with ingredients grown and processed under strict organic standards.
